Abstract

India has continually sought to attract FDI from the world’s major investors. FDI has played a important role in development of Indian economy. India has today become a budding target for FDI. With high purchasing power of Indian men, India now offers more lucrative and profitable market for investors. Its growing economy and growth is becoming an eye treat for foreign companies to expand their business and operations overseas. FDI in India has in a lot of ways enabled India to achieve a certain degree of financial stability, growth and development. FDI no doubt is creating innovation in retail sector but simultaneously it may pull down the local and domestic retailers of India which is surely a concern to worry about for Indian government.
